Together, we will enable the financial sector to move confidently into the quantum era, delivering secure, resilient connectivity designed not only for today’s demands, but for the challenges of tomorrow.”</span></i></p><p style="text-align:justify;"><span><strong>Quantum Key Distribution offers a new form of encryption security</strong></span><br><span>QKD uses a data encryption key based on quantum technology that is resistant to attempted interception. QKD helps protect valuable data from possible future attacks using quantum computers, playing a vital role in securing critical infrastructure, for example in the financial area.&nbsp;<strong> </strong>This technology allows scalable and cost-effective quantum encrypted fiber connections, enabling the many businesses between Brussels, Amsterdam and London to be connected via breach-proof connections.</span></p><img style="aspect-ratio:157/auto;width:157px;" src="https://content.presspage.com/uploads/2593/63b6ea80-9f14-455a-a9dd-d066d9d3fb55/500_colt_technology_services_logo.png?x=1773764419649" width="157" alt="Colt_Technology_Services_Logo" height="auto"><p style="text-align:justify;">&nbsp;</p><p style="text-align:justify;">&nbsp;</p><p style="text-align:justify;">&nbsp;</p><p style="text-align:justify;"><span><strong>About Colt Technology Services</strong></span><br><span>We’re Colt. With this addition, Eurofiber takes the next step in delivering secure, scalable and future-proof private mobile networks for business users.</strong></span></p><p><span><strong>5G RedCap: a logical extension to a mature ecosystem</strong></span><br><span>Together with Nokia and the other strategic partners, Eurofiber is building a Private 5G ecosystem based on secure, scalable and sector-specific 5G solutions on top of Eurofiber’s fiber infrastructure. 5G RedCap fits seamlessly into this strategy. The technology is designed for large-scale IoT applications that require reliability and low latency, but not the full 5G bandwidth. It offers lower complexity than full 5G modems, reduced energy consumption, affordable modules, and support for large numbers of IoT devices such as sensors, wearables and cameras.</span></p><p><span><strong>Growing demand in industry, logistics, healthcare and construction</strong></span><br><span>In virtually all sectors, demand for scalable IoT connectivity is increasing — a trend Eurofiber sees clearly in the market. By making 5G RedCap available within the private network, a crucial missing link in modern IoT connectivity is filled. No Dutch operator has commercially rolled out 5G RedCap yet, making this private 5G ecosystem once again a frontrunner.</span></p><p><span><strong>Secure, scalable and economically attractive</strong></span><br><span>5G RedCap makes it possible to start IoT projects easily and scale them up step by step without major upfront investments. This aligns with the existing private 5G service model and creates opportunities in industry, healthcare, logistics and construction.<strong> </strong>With 5G RedCap, integrating OT equipment and IT networks also becomes easier. The technology enables real-time data collection with reliable coverage and low latency in dynamic environments. Thanks to the implementation of 5G RedCap, IoT devices can now be directly connected to Eurofiber’s secure, open fiber backbone — a major advantage compared to WiFi, BLE or LPWAN technologies.</span></p><img style="aspect-ratio:407/auto;" src="https://content.presspage.com/uploads/2593/3fc527c4-9963-419e-a205-4d4d9412d6d1/800_mwc26prakashsadagopannokia-phaedrakortekaaseurofiber-cropped.jpg?x=1772450996596" alt="MWC26 Prakash Sadagopan Nokia - Phaedra Kortekaas Eurofiber-cropped" width="407" height="auto"><p>&nbsp;</p><p>&nbsp;</p><p>&nbsp;</p><p>&nbsp;</p><p>&nbsp;</p><p>&nbsp;</p><p>&nbsp;</p><p>&nbsp;</p><p>&nbsp;</p><p>&nbsp;</p><p>&nbsp;</p><p>&nbsp;</p><p>&nbsp;</p><p><span><strong>Phaedra Kortekaas, Managing Director Eurofiber Netherlands </strong></span><i><span>“With the introduction of 5G RedCap within our Private 5G ecosystem, we are giving our customers a powerful new building block for their digital transformation.                         <guid>https://www.eurofiber.com/press/eurofiber-and-antin-infrastructure-partners-a-decade-long-winning-partnership/</guid><pp:caseid>720781</pp:caseid><description><![CDATA[<p><i><span>"This year marks two important milestones: Eurofiber’s 25<sup>th</sup> anniversary and our 10<sup>th</sup> year of partnership with Antin,” </span></i><span>says<strong> Alex Goldblum, CEO of Eurofiber</strong></span><i><span>. “In the ten years since Antin Infrastructure Partners acquired Eurofiber, our company has evolved from a scale-up mainly in the Netherlands to become the leading European provider of open access digital infrastructure. Together, we have expanded our horizons, embraced innovation, and consistently delivered exceptional value to our customers. We are proud of the journey we embarked upon together and are in equal measure excited about the future; a future in which secure digital infrastructure will only increase in importance.”</span></i></p><p><span>When Antin Infrastructure Partners acquired Eurofiber as part of its Flagship Fund II, the company operated mainly in the Netherlands, had revenues of about €130 million, a fiber-optic network of 18,000 km and about 3,000 customers. Over the past 10 years, with Antin’s support, Eurofiber has more than doubled its revenues to over 300 million euros at end-2024, operates in 4 countries, has grown its fiber optic network four-fold to more than 76,000 kilometers and tripled its customer base to about 9,000 customers. In the Netherlands, Eurofiber has become the leading B2B connectivity provider.</span></p><p><i><span>“We were attracted from the start by Eurofiber’s stellar track-record, talented management team and strong growth potential, as well as by the fact that they viewed their business with an infrastructure mindset,</span></i><span>” says <strong>Stéphane Ifker, Managing Partner of Antin Infrastructure Partners</strong>. </span><i><span>“We shared their vision of expanding the company's presence into multiple markets, anticipating the increasing demand for open access networks and the expected internationalization of the industry, and we’re very pleased to see that one decade on, this ambition has clearly been realized.”</span></i></p><p style="text-align:justify;"><span>Eurofiber quickly got down to business after Antin’s entry, combining both organic growth and acquisitions, with more than €1.5 billion of capital expenditure deployed into the Eurofiber network to grow it by some 58,000 kilometers. Expansion started with the acquisition of B-Telecom in 2015, adding 7,500km network and nationwide coverage in Belgium. A year later, Eurofiber acquired Dataplace to complement dark and lit connectivity offering with regional edge co-location. Today, the Eurofiber Cloud Infra business unit comprises of 11 sites with a total capacity of 24MW across the Netherlands and France, providing (hybrid) cloud infrastructure services including liquid cooling and high-performance computing (HPC) capabilities in select sites.</span></p><p><span>In 2019, Eurofiber and Antin crossed new borders again with the acquisition of three companies in Northern France, Eurafibre, Eura DC and ATE, laying the foundations for the creation of a nationwide platform targeting 25 metro areas by the end of 2025. At the same time, a dedicated International Business Unit was established to serve global carriers and hyperscalers, addressing their cross-border connectivity needs.</span></p><p><span>In 2020, joint ventures in Belgium (Unifiber, with Proximus) and Berlin (Eurofiber Netz, initially Vattenfall-Eurofiber) led to the successful deployment of wholesale Fibre-to-the-Home networks. These initiatives have created a footprint of approximately 360,000 homes passed to date, with more than 15 ISPs, including Proximus, 1&1, Telefónica, Pÿur, and Vodafone. The overall future target is to reach around 1.1 million homes passed.&nbsp;</span><br><span>Also in 2020, Eurofiber welcomed Dutch pension investor PGGM alongside Antin, which renewed its commitment as majority shareholder.</span></p><p><span>In 2021, Eurofiber further expanded its presence in Germany through a partnership with NGN, adding another 19,000 km to its pan-European network.</span></p><p><i><span>&nbsp;“The strength of our partnership lies in our shared vision of the vital role that open access digital infrastructure plays in the economy and society,”</span></i><span> says Alex Goldblum.</span></p><p><span>Additionally, Eurofiber has established itself as a leader in sustainability, achieving a Platinum EcoVadis rating in 2024, which places it in the top 1% of all companies assessed globally. Eurofiber has also made a public commitment to long-term decarbonization by formalizing a science-based target, approved by the Science Based Targets Initiative (SBTi), to achieve net zero emissions across all scopes by 2040.</span></p><p><span>Recognizing the vital importance of quantum secure networks for the resilience of our digital society, Eurofiber has been at the forefront of innovation, designing and building quantum communication links and proposing Quantum Key Distribution (QKD) networks. This commitment to innovation has resulted in operational quantum networks in locations such as the Port of Rotterdam. Eurofiber's innovation capabilities have been acknowledged through several prestigious awards, including IT Infrastructure Innovator of the Year 2022 (Data News, Belgium), Networking & Edge Innovator of the Year 2025 (Dutch IT Channel), and runner-up CyberSec Europe Award 2025.</span></p><p><i><span>“Innovation and sustainability are ingrained into how Eurofiber runs its business,” </span></i><span>says <strong>Antin Senior Partner Simon Soder</strong></span><i><span>. “Eurofiber’s infrastructure is a critical enabler for its customers when it comes to adoption of technologies such as AI and quantum computing, and at the same time fiber is also a more energy-efficient form of connectivity than the alternatives.”</span></i></p><img style="aspect-ratio:604/auto;" src="https://content.presspage.com/uploads/2593/44db3aab-ab4b-4fbd-88c2-d59570d77464/1920_antineurofiber10jaar.png?x=1756970452217" alt="Antin Eurofiber 10 jaar" width="604" height="auto">]]></description><category><![CDATA[company,business,finance,#news]]></category>

                        <guid>https://www.eurofiber.com/press/why-europe-should-not-disrupt-investor-confidence-in-fixed-markets/</guid><pp:caseid>713856</pp:caseid><pp:subtitle>Regulatory certainty needed to drive investment in connectivity</pp:subtitle><description><![CDATA[<p>For decades, European consumers and businesses have benefitted from choice, value and innovation in fixed broadband infrastructure, underpinned by a predictable and established regulatory framework that has lowered barriers to entry. European regulation sought to strike a balance between competition and incentivising the long-term investment required to build and run high-quality, gigabit fixed fibre connectivity.&nbsp;<br><br>In contrast to mobile, fixed access including ducts and poles remains a de facto natural monopoly across much of the EU and is impossible to fully replicate.&nbsp;<br>To serve European businesses and enterprises, operators must also offer connectivity at a variety of urban and rural sites. Given that only incumbent operators have nationwide coverage, wholesale access remains key.&nbsp;<br><br>It is therefore alarming that the European Commission is now proposing to relax regulation on former fixed monopolies.&nbsp;<br>We believe that the Commission’s proposals are a backwards step. Deregulation of wholesale access would lead to re-monopolisation and stifle competition and investment in fixed connectivity services, particularly during the migration from copper to fibre.&nbsp;<br><br>This approach contrasts starkly with the principles of competition as a driver for investment that the Commission has rightly championed for decades. And it would entrench dominance, notably in underserved areas, imperilling the pace of full fibre infrastructure rollout and gigabit-capable services for millions of Europeans.&nbsp;<br>It would therefore be both premature and significantly undermine regulatory certainty if Europe departs from the well-established ex-ante model or removes all markets from the Recommendation on Relevant Markets (RRM).&nbsp;<br><br>This would result in a less competitive investment case for fixed telecoms in Europe, stranding billions of euros committed by the private sector and reducing investor sentiment.&nbsp;<br><br>The current Commission’s proposals would further suppress future take up of services by consumers and businesses, inhibit network innovation, and make it more challenging for Europe to achieve its Digital Decade 2030 targets.&nbsp;<br>Instead, we urge the Commission to enshrine a predictable framework for fixed infrastructure based on the following principles:&nbsp;<br><br>1.<strong> Preserve the ex-ante model to spur competition and investment in the sector and increase consumer choice and take-up.</strong>&nbsp;<br>Ex-ante regulation remains essential for wholesale local access (market one) and wholesale dedicated capacity for business connectivity (market two) - including dark fibre access. Symmetric obligations under the Gigabit Infrastructure Act are not a substitute for targeted remedies aimed at taming excessive market power such as access to passive fibre services, especially in areas where infrastructure competition is unlikely to emerge.&nbsp;<br><br>2.<strong> Ensure access to physical infrastructure, including ducts and poles.&nbsp;</strong><br>In many EU member states, this infrastructure is still largely controlled by a single operator, creating a de facto monopoly.&nbsp;<br><br>3. <strong>Complete the Digital Networks Act before considering changes to the RRM framework.&nbsp;</strong><br>The EU’s connectivity strategy in the Digital Networks Act should be implemented and its impact fully assessed before the Commission should consider changes to the RRM framework. The Commission must adequately consider that national regulators still find a need to regulate markets one and two. Of the 27 EU NRAs, 23 currently regulate market one and 15 regulate market two.&nbsp;<br>Long-term investment in fibre networks depends on regulatory certainty. But Europe’s Digital Decade 2030 ambitions can only be achieved if the Commission adopts a balanced, evidence-based approach to regulation of the fixed telecoms market.&nbsp;<br>Without this, Europe’s digital future will continue to falter as global competitors race ahead, leading to weak productivity growth, stagnant living standards and a less secure continent.&nbsp;<br><br><i>We therefore call on the Commission to work closely with industry and national regulators to ensure that the regulatory framework continues to support both investment and competition for all players.&nbsp;</i><br><br>The undersigned companies collectively operate networks across all 27 Member States of the European Union, serving around 240 million customers.&nbsp;<br>Edward Bouygues, <strong>Chairman, Bouygues Telecom&nbsp;</strong><br>Keri Gilder, <strong>CEO, Colt Technology Services&nbsp;</strong><br>Alex Goldblum, <strong>CEO, Eurofiber&nbsp;</strong><br>Walter Renna, <strong>CEO, Fastweb+Vodafone (Italy)&nbsp;</strong><br>Thomas Reynaud, <strong>CEO, iliad Group&nbsp;</strong><br>Giuseppe Gola, <strong>CEO, Open Fiber&nbsp;</strong><br>Robert Finnegan, <strong>CKHH-HWEL Deputy Chairman, CK Hutchison Group Telecom (Three Group)&nbsp;</strong><br>Ralph Dommermuth, <strong>CEO, 1&1 AG&nbsp;</strong><br>Margherita Della Valle, <strong>CEO, Vodafone Group Plc</strong></p>]]></description><category><![CDATA[company,business,news]]></category>

                        <guid>https://www.eurofiber.com/press/eurofiber-partners-with-quantum-bridge-and-juniper-networks-to-enhance-quantum-safe-infrastructure-solutions/</guid><pp:caseid>681592</pp:caseid><pp:subtitle>Eurofiber selects Quantum Bridge to secure its networks against quantum cyber attacks</pp:subtitle><description><![CDATA[<p><span>Eurofiber announces a new strategic partnership with Quantum Bridge, a pioneer in distributed symmetric key establishment (DSKE) technology, and Juniper Networks. This collaboration makes quantum-safe communication solutions and expanded secure data transfer capabilities available for organizations across Eurofiber's network.</span></p><p><span>A steady increase in cyber threats and evolving global regulatory requirements are driving a spike in demand for quantum-safe encryption. Eurofiber is therefore partnering with Juniper Networks and Quantum Bridge to integrate advanced post-quantum cryptography into its extensive network infrastructure. This partnership positions the companies at the forefront of the emerging quantum technology market, securing these networks from cyberattacks using a quantum computer by combining Juniper Networks’ SRX firewalls with Quantum Bridge’s DSKE technology.</span></p><p><span>Quantum Bridge's patented DSKE technology does not rely on traditional asymmetric cryptography, a part of today’s encryption which is both widely used and vulnerable to quantum cyberattacks. DSKE is an unbreakable security solution which seamlessly integrates with existing firewalls and infrastructure, enabling Eurofiber to provide scalable, future-proof security for its clients. By combining cutting-edge key distribution technology with Eurofiber’s reliable connectivity, sensitive customer data is automatically protected against potential attacks using a quantum computer.</span></p><p><i><span>Partnering with Juniper and Quantum Bridge strengthens our commitment to secure and reliable connectivity. The partnership leverages our position as a leader in the fiberoptic market and ensures our customers are protected against evolving cyber threats, including those posed by quantum computing. Over the past few years, we have collaborated with partners to test various advanced technologies, including Post Quantum Cryptography, QKD and DSKE”</span></i><span> said <strong>Eric Kuisch, COO at Eurofiber.</strong></span></p><p><span><strong>DSKE technology</strong></span><br><span>Distributed symmetric key establishment (DSKE) is an advanced and highly scalable key distribution technology trusted by large financial institutions, enterprise clients, and service providers that require a multi-layer, defense-in-depth security strategy. It fully automates the creation and distribution of symmetric keys, without relying on computational complexity or asymmetric encryption. DSKE is the industry’s first scalable symmetric key distribution technology, combining the scalability of public key infrastructure (PKI), the security of quantum key distribution (QKD) and the simplicity of pre-shared keys.</span></p><p><span><strong>Quantum-safe financial systems</strong></span><br><span>Recently, Eurofiber successfully showcased the DSKE technology in a high-security environment.&nbsp;</span><br><span>At a recent meeting of central banks in Rome, representatives from G7 countries discussed the cryptographic risks associated with the advancement of quantum computing. On that occasion, Eurofiber demonstrated how the Quantum Bridge DSKE technology combined with Juniper Networks SRX firewalls can play a leading role in securing the financial system from attacks by malicious actors using quantum computers. The demonstration was attended by global leaders in central banking and commercial banking who agreed that now is the time to plan an orderly migration of the financial system towards quantum-safe encryption.</span></p><p><i><span>“Our collaboration with Eurofiber and Juniper Networks represents a significant step forward in delivering quantum-safe communication solutions to a rapidly expanding pool of customers.                         <guid>https://www.eurofiber.com/press/eurofiber-and-odido-renew-strategic-partnership-for-business-based-fiberoptic-connections/</guid><pp:caseid>677016</pp:caseid><description><![CDATA[<p><span>Eurofiber and Odido have announced the renewal of their strategic partnership, focused on the expansion of the fiberoptic network specifically for companies and business parks. This successful partnership lets business customers benefit from Odido’s high-quality services provided through Eurofiber’s reliable fiberoptic network. Since the partnership began in 2016, the two sides have jointly rolled out fiberoptic cable to thousands of businesses. The new partnership agreement has a ten-year term.</span></p><p><span><strong>Essential infrastructure for the business market</strong></span><br><span>The renewal of this partnership highlights the critical importance of Fiber to the Office (FttO) solutions for the business market. By laying high-quality fiberoptic connections, Eurofiber and Odido are providing the infrastructure that is vitally important to modern business operations. This infrastructure provides not only the highest standards of service quality and reliability, but also offers greater flexibility to respond to changing customer needs in terms of speed, capacity and new business locations.</span></p><p><span>In this partnership, Odido has full control over the active layer of the network along with the services provided, operating through Eurofiber’s fiberoptic infrastructure. In order to offer the highest quality of service, Odido manages the technology and equipment needed to regulate and optimize data traffic. Odido can also respond quickly to technological innovations and customer needs to deliver customized solutions aligned with each company’s specific requirements.</span></p><p><span><strong>Sustainability and efficiency</strong></span><br><span>A key aspect of this partnership is the drive towards sustainability, which is in line with the broader Environmental, Social, and Governance (ESG) goals of both companies. The cooperation between Eurofiber and Odido prevents the construction of parallel fiberoptic networks, while minimizing infrastructure construction. An efficient rollout of advanced network services reduces inconvenience, lowers the risk of disruption to existing infrastructure and avoids redundant investments.</span></p><img style="aspect-ratio:449/auto;" src="https://content.presspage.com/uploads/2593/6ba3a0b1-e3ea-4c70-8a26-aa51c42b9fcc/800_logo039sodidozakelijkeurofiber-cropped.jpg?x=1730793662273" alt="Logo's Odido zakelijk Eurofiber-cropped" width="449" height="auto">]]></description><pp:quotes><pp:quote>
